Handover: Keyturner rotation utility

Taking over from Marek as of Monday. Keyturner rotates service credentials on a 30-day cycle; failures page the platform channel, not support, but support gets the customer-facing fallout. Common ticket: apps caching old credentials past rotation — tell them to restart the consumer, don't re-rotate. Never run a manual rotation without checking the freeze calendar. Rotation schedule, known-flaky services, and the manual procedure are all documented on this page.

dashboard of kawip-kajep = https://jira.qorvellabs.internal/display/browse/projects/projects/a194

Minutes — Management Meeting, Quillford Retail

Attendees: S. Harrow, D. Lindqvist, P. Maren. The overhaul of the Everbloom loyalty programme was examined in detail. Points liabilities will be revalued at the new redemption rate, requiring a one-time adjustment to the deferred revenue account. Finance is asked to model breakage scenarios at 12% and 18% before sign-off. Migration of legacy members begins next quarter. A confidential item for the finance team is recorded below.

confidential, kagep-kahof: Druokax Systems plans to lower the Ulaath list price by 53 percent in March.

## Notes — CSV Import Wizard Sync

Quick recap for the new folks: the Pinloft import wizard now does a dry-run preview before committing rows, which cut support tickets way down. We still choke on files with mixed date formats — that's the top open bug. Column mapping suggestions come from the Saffron matcher service, so if mappings look weird, check its logs first, not the wizard. We agreed to ship the delimiter auto-detect fix next sprint. Questions about the wizard roadmap should go to the person named below.

account owner for bawip-tahag: Raleth Quenok

Welcome to the Mirelight platform team. Our primary Postgres cluster uses PgBouncer in transaction mode; keep pool sizes at 20 per service unless load tests justify more. Connection leaks page the on-call, so always release handles in a finally block. To unlock the pooling config vault during incidents, use the recovery passphrase below.

unlock words, fafop-hawep: briwyn-oliix-sorox